Analysis
Slovakia recorded 732.86 Thousand tonnes for imports of oil and petroleum products by partner country - monthly in 2026.
The figure is up 4.2% on the previous year and up 8.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, imports of oil and petroleum products by partner country - monthly in Slovakia peaked at 737.06 Thousand tonnes in 2023 and was at its lowest, 516.26 Thousand tonnes, in 2020.
That places Slovakia 23rd out of 47 countries with data for 2026,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 14 years of available data.
Imports of oil and petroleum products by partner country - monthly in Slovakia, year by year
| Year | Thousand tonnes |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2013 | 602 Thousand tonnes | — |
| 2014 | 583 Thousand tonnes | -3.2% |
| 2015 | 656 Thousand tonnes | +12.5% |
| 2016 | 677 Thousand tonnes | +3.2% |
| 2017 | 699 Thousand tonnes | +3.2% |
| 2018 | 672 Thousand tonnes | -3.9% |
| 2019 | 630 Thousand tonnes | -6.2% |
| 2020 | 516.26 Thousand tonnes | -18.1% |
| 2021 | 608.11 Thousand tonnes | +17.8% |
| 2022 | 663.78 Thousand tonnes | +9.2% |
| 2023 | 737.06 Thousand tonnes | +11.0% |
| 2024 | 585.68 Thousand tonnes | -20.5% |
| 2025 | 703.4 Thousand tonnes | +20.1% |
| 2026 | 732.86 Thousand tonnes | +4.2% |
